Transaction 73aae569712eeb46e8af8d7b2f573e81a98c5de2fcedbb6a29eb7c204580d61e

1 Input
2 Outputs
  • 73aae569712eeb46e8af8d7b2f573e81a98c5de2fcedbb6a29eb7c204580d61e:0
  • value  302483920
    address  3CoMo9UGWDArGdokf6mYqxaD6deSVWQ7UU
  • 73aae569712eeb46e8af8d7b2f573e81a98c5de2fcedbb6a29eb7c204580d61e:1
  • value  55300000
    address  39zw7TUm37yVHEkVrcxpauyVTNNbGVrUxj